When you begin intermittent fasting, especially as a beginner managing diabetes, blood pressure, and hormonal changes, your body can interpret the eating window as a stressor. This triggers elevated cortisol and other stress hormones like adrenaline. In the short term, mild cortisol spikes help mobilize fat for energy. But chronic elevation—common in people with past diet failures and joint pain—promotes abdominal fat storage, increases hunger signals, and disrupts insulin sensitivity. After 35 years in healthcare, I’ve seen this pattern repeatedly in patients who feel wired yet exhausted during fasting attempts.
At ages 45-54, declining estrogen or testosterone combined with life stressors amplify cortisol’s effects.
